Transaction 23f6e51be9c6dee69e819d9a4f98941833e26ffb4f56713970d75dc52b064500

1 Input
2 Outputs
  • 23f6e51be9c6dee69e819d9a4f98941833e26ffb4f56713970d75dc52b064500:0
  • value  16123031091
    address  3Mznk4FygAzpCiVXCJAvMk4mbny6mqvHQv
  • 23f6e51be9c6dee69e819d9a4f98941833e26ffb4f56713970d75dc52b064500:1
  • value  21214
    address  3JxhqRfJ4kkqoiJnToKbGTFrVLj8KGYseM